Celebrating 70 Years of DofE at Buckingham Palace

What a day to remember! Under glorious sunshine and surrounded by the immaculate gardens of Buckingham Palace, celebrations took place to mark the 70th anniversary of the Duke of Edinburgh’s Award, a truly special occasion recognising decades of adventure, service, resilience and achievement.


Representing Bethany School at this prestigious event was Mr Reilly, who joined guests from across the country to celebrate the incredible impact of the DofE programme. The atmosphere was buzzing with excitement as attendees enjoyed an afternoon of inspiring speeches, delicious tea and cake and the rare opportunity to explore the stunning palace grounds.

A number of well-known guest speakers took to the stage during the celebrations, including Hugh Bonneville, Larry Lamb and Alex Jones, each sharing reflections on the importance of perseverance, opportunity and personal growth through the Award.

The celebrations concluded with speeches from Prince Edward, whose words highlighted the lasting legacy of the Award and the remarkable achievements of young people over the past 70 years.

Bethany was especially proud to see several of our Gold DofE alumni in attendance, continuing the school’s strong tradition of participation and success in the Award. Pictured with Mr Reilly was current pupil Aubrey along with Bethany alumni Lily, Elsa and Henri, all representing the spirit of challenge, commitment and adventure that the DofE inspires.

It was a memorable occasion and a wonderful celebration of an award that continues to shape and inspire young people at Bethany and beyond
